Fha 203K Streamline Process 203K Before And After About homestead funding. homestead Funding Corp. is a multi-state licensed mortgage lender with branches located throughout the eastern U.S. In operation since 1995, our corporate headquarters is located in Albany, New York where we have perennially been the.What is an FHA Limited (Streamline) 203(k) Loan? Designed specifically for homes that may need cosmetic repairs or upgrades, the Limited (formerly known as Streamline) 203(k) Loan is intended for homes that can be remodeled, repaired, or updated for less than $35,000.

FHA 203k loans are a type of home improvement loan that allow you to purchase a home in need of repairs plus get extra cash to renovate the home. 203k loans are a type of FHA loan, they have the same qualifying requirements as FHA loans and the same low 3.5% down payment.
